Mainer wrote:Per Remington my shotgun was manufactured in 2015. My barrel is stamped 'IO' which didn't make sense. 1994? No 'I' in the month list. It has to be upside down 'OI' equals July 2015.
As far as I understand it, "J" is the letter for 2015; "I" should be 2014. But keep in mind that barrel date codes are often not stamped very well. I've seen many barrels with garbled or partially-stamped letters. A badly-stamped "J" could very well look like an "I".
